Methylstenbolone, known by, the: nicknames M-Sten, Methyl-Sten, and Ultradrol, is: a synthetic and orally active anabolic–androgenic steroid (AAS) and a 17α-methylated derivative of dihydrotestosterone (DHT) which was never introduced for medical use. It is a designer steroid and has been sold via the——internet marketed as a dietary/nutritional supplement.

Chemistry

Methylstenbolone, also known as 2,17α-dimethyl-δ-4,5α-dihydrotestosterone (2,17α-dimethyl-δ-DHT)/as 2,17α-dimethyl-5α-androst-1-en-17β-ol-3-one, is a synthetic androstane steroid and a 17α-alkylated derivative of DHT. It is the 17α-methylated derivative of stenbolone, as well as the δ-isomer of methasterone (2α,17α-dimethyl-DHT). Related AAS include mestanolone and methyl-1-testosterone.
